  • Indications d'application

    This affinity purified antibody detects human PDK-1 and has been tested for use in ELISAand immunoblotting. Although untested, this reagent may be useful for Immunohistochemistry andImmunoprecipitation. It recognizes 60,000 MW human PDK-1. Reactivity in otherimmunoassays is unknown. Recommended Dilutions: This product has been assayed by immunoblot using HRPGoat-anti-Rabbit IgG [H&L] and Enhanced Chemiluminescence for detection. A workingdilution range of 1: 750 is suggested to detect PDK-1 in lysates derived from Sf9 insect cellsinfected with virus expressing myc-tagged human PDK1. In this experiment, approx. 10 μg of bothan untransfected sf9 cell lysate (not shown) and PDK-1 virus-infected Sf9 lysate wereseparated on a 10 % gel by SDS-PAGE followed by transfer to nitrocellulose. Primaryantibody reaction proceeded overnight at 4C using a 1: 750 dilution of the antibody in 1 %non-fat milk. This antibody predominantly recognizes a 60 kDa band corresponding tohuman PDK-1.

    Sujet

    PDK-1 (3-Phosphoinositide-Dependant Protein Kinase-1) phosphorylates AGC kinases. PDK-1 activates conventional PKC and PKCz (zeta) through phosphorylation of critical threonine residues in the activation loop. PDK-1 also phosphorylates Protein Kinase B (PKB) at threonine 308 in the presence of phosphatidylinositol-3,4,5-trisphosphate. Active Akt inactivates Glycogen Synthase Kinase-3 (GSK3), eventually leading to the dephosphorylation and activation of glycogen synthase, and the stimulation of glycogen synthesis. Because of the role that PDK1 plays in insulin-induced glycogen synthesis and PKC activation, it is a potentially important target for metabolic drug research.Synonyms: 3-phosphoinositide-dependent proteinkinase 1, PDK-1, PDK1, PDPK1, hPDK1
